BSSPD: A Blockchain-Based Security Sharing Scheme for Personal Data with Fine-Grained Access Control

被引:21
|
作者
Gao, Hongmin [1 ]
Ma, Zhaofeng [1 ]
Luo, Shoushan [1 ]
Xu, Yanping [2 ]
Wu, Zheng [3 ]
机构
[1] Beijing Univ Posts & Telecommun, Informat Secur Ctr, Beijing 100876, Peoples R China
[2] Hangzhou Dianzi Univ, Sch Cyberspace Secur, Hangzhou 310018, Zhejiang, Peoples R China
[3] Hunan Univ Sci & Engn, Sch Elect & Informat Engn, Wuhan, Peoples R China
基金
中国国家自然科学基金;
关键词
D O I
10.1155/2021/6658920
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Privacy protection and open sharing are the core of data governance in the AI-driven era. A common data-sharing management platform is indispensable in the existing data-sharing solutions, and users upload their data to the cloud server for storage and dissemination. However, from the moment users upload the data to the server, they will lose absolute ownership of their data, and security and privacy will become a critical issue. Although data encryption and access control are considered up-and-coming technologies in protecting personal data security on the cloud server, they alleviate this problem to a certain extent. However, it still depends too much on a third-party organization's credibility, the Cloud Service Provider (CSP). In this paper, we combined blockchain, ciphertext-policy attribute-based encryption (CP-ABE), and InterPlanetary File System (IPFS) to address this problem to propose a blockchain-based security sharing scheme for personal data named BSSPD. In this user-centric scheme, the data owner encrypts the sharing data and stores it on IPFS, which maximizes the scheme's decentralization. The address and the decryption key of the shared data will be encrypted with CP-ABE according to the specific access policy, and the data owner uses blockchain to publish his data-related information and distribute keys for data users. Only the data user whose attributes meet the access policy can download and decrypt the data. The data owner has fine-grained access control over his data, and BSSPD supports an attribute-level revocation of a specific data user without affecting others. To further protect the data user's privacy, the ciphertext keyword search is used when retrieving data. We analyzed the security of the BBSPD and simulated our scheme on the EOS blockchain, which proved that our scheme is feasible. Meanwhile, we provided a thorough analysis of the storage and computing overhead, which proved that BSSPD has a good performance.
引用
收藏
页数:20
相关论文
共 50 条
  • [1] BDSS-FA: A Blockchain-Based Data Security Sharing Platform With Fine-Grained Access Control
    Xu, Hong
    He, Qian
    Li, Xuecong
    Jiang, Bingcheng
    Qin, Kuangyu
    [J]. IEEE ACCESS, 2020, 8 : 87552 - 87561
  • [2] A Blockchain-based Secure Cloud Files Sharing Scheme with Fine-Grained Access Control
    Liu, Yuke
    Zhang, Junwei
    Gao, Qi
    [J]. 2018 INTERNATIONAL CONFERENCE ON NETWORKING AND NETWORK APPLICATIONS (NANA), 2018, : 277 - 283
  • [3] BDSS: Blockchain-based Data Sharing Scheme With Fine-grained Access Control And Permission Revocation In Medical Environment
    Zhang, Lejun
    Zou, Yanfei
    Yousuf, Muhammad Hassam
    Wang, Weizheng
    Jin, Zilong
    Su, Yansen
    Seokhoon, Kim
    [J]. KSII TRANSACTIONS ON INTERNET AND INFORMATION SYSTEMS, 2022, 16 (05): : 1634 - 1652
  • [4] A Blockchain-Based Fine-Grained Access Data Control Scheme With Attribute Change Function
    Wang, Xiaochao
    Zhou, Zequan
    Luo, Xiling
    Xu, Yifu
    Bai, Yi
    Luo, Feixiang
    [J]. 2021 IEEE SMARTWORLD, UBIQUITOUS INTELLIGENCE & COMPUTING, ADVANCED & TRUSTED COMPUTING, SCALABLE COMPUTING & COMMUNICATIONS, INTERNET OF PEOPLE, AND SMART CITY INNOVATIONS (SMARTWORLD/SCALCOM/UIC/ATC/IOP/SCI 2021), 2021, : 348 - 356
  • [5] Achieving fine-grained and flexible access control on blockchain-based data sharing for the Internet of Things
    Wang, Ruimiao
    Wang, Xiaodong
    Yang, Wenti
    Yuan, Shuai
    Guan, Zhitao
    [J]. CHINA COMMUNICATIONS, 2022, 19 (06) : 22 - 34
  • [6] Achieving Fine-Grained and Flexible Access Control on Blockchain-Based Data Sharing for the Internet of Things
    Ruimiao Wang
    Xiaodong Wang
    Wenti Yang
    Shuai Yuan
    Zhitao Guan
    [J]. China Communications, 2022, (06) : 22 - 34
  • [7] A Blockchain-Based Framework for Data Sharing With Fine-Grained Access Control in Decentralized Storage Systems
    Wang, Shangping
    Zhang, Yinglong
    Zhang, Yaling
    [J]. IEEE ACCESS, 2018, 6 : 38437 - 38450
  • [8] A blockchain-based fine-grained data sharing scheme for e-healthcare system
    Lin, Gaofan
    Wang, Haijiang
    Wan, Jian
    Zhang, Lei
    Huang, Jie
    [J]. JOURNAL OF SYSTEMS ARCHITECTURE, 2022, 132
  • [9] A blockchain-based framework for electronic medical records sharing with fine-grained access control
    Sun, Jin
    Ren, Lili
    Wang, Shangping
    Yao, Xiaomin
    [J]. PLOS ONE, 2020, 15 (10):
  • [10] FADB: A Fine-Grained Access Control Scheme for VANET Data Based on Blockchain
    Li, Hui
    Pei, Lishuang
    Liao, Dan
    Chen, Song
    Zhang, Ming
    Xu, Du
    [J]. IEEE ACCESS, 2020, 8 : 85190 - 85203